summaryrefslogtreecommitdiffstats
path: root/src/com/android/launcher3/LauncherAnimUtils.java
diff options
context:
space:
mode:
authorMichael Jurka <mikejurka@google.com>2013-10-21 15:57:08 -0700
committerDanesh M <daneshm90@gmail.com>2014-01-24 16:23:31 -0800
commite7f6abe44a168da02a0520323fd5f308ed31cb28 (patch)
tree1cbedd5e1e754ec7fd6a6796693bebe556c6288e /src/com/android/launcher3/LauncherAnimUtils.java
parent620ed68709705518d649c2163e4bfcb23de7fa2b (diff)
downloadandroid_packages_apps_Trebuchet-e7f6abe44a168da02a0520323fd5f308ed31cb28.tar.gz
android_packages_apps_Trebuchet-e7f6abe44a168da02a0520323fd5f308ed31cb28.tar.bz2
android_packages_apps_Trebuchet-e7f6abe44a168da02a0520323fd5f308ed31cb28.zip
DO NOT MERGE: Fix leak when animations are created but never started
Bug: 11322014 (cherry picked from commit e206ff0f73e9821e7454810779f3f88d4a8deabb) Change-Id: I5aaf76d7c96e4a7878946d7de337acd858c11f44
Diffstat (limited to 'src/com/android/launcher3/LauncherAnimUtils.java')
-rw-r--r--src/com/android/launcher3/LauncherAnimUtils.java2
1 files changed, 1 insertions, 1 deletions
diff --git a/src/com/android/launcher3/LauncherAnimUtils.java b/src/com/android/launcher3/LauncherAnimUtils.java
index 01f72a7ce..5d4f9c67e 100644
--- a/src/com/android/launcher3/LauncherAnimUtils.java
+++ b/src/com/android/launcher3/LauncherAnimUtils.java
@@ -30,6 +30,7 @@ public class LauncherAnimUtils {
static HashSet<Animator> sAnimators = new HashSet<Animator>();
static Animator.AnimatorListener sEndAnimListener = new Animator.AnimatorListener() {
public void onAnimationStart(Animator animation) {
+ sAnimators.add(animation);
}
public void onAnimationRepeat(Animator animation) {
@@ -45,7 +46,6 @@ public class LauncherAnimUtils {
};
public static void cancelOnDestroyActivity(Animator a) {
- sAnimators.add(a);
a.addListener(sEndAnimListener);
}